RUGBY LEAGUE KOHINOOR CLUB CLOSES YEAR

The annual social of the Kohinoor Rugby League Club was held at the Blaketown Hall on Saturday afternoon, Mr N. C. Messenger presiding over a large attendance of players, parents and supporters. The following trophies were presented:— Campbell Cup, fourth grade champions; Clarke Cup, fifth grade championship; Pollock Memorial Cup, fifth grade one round competition; Hobbs Memorial Cup and miniature (club spirit), J. Dobbin; W. Messenger Cup and miniature (most improved player), E. Brennan; K. Mountfora Cup (most conscientious trainee), W. Cairney; Club Cup (most improved schoolboy), N. Harris. The following toasts were honoured: —Loyal Toast; “West Coast Rugby League” (proposed by Mr E. Kerridge and responded to by Mr T. F. McKenzie) ; “Kohinoor Club” (Mr H. Bullock—Mr C. Morel); “Sister Clubs” (Mr D. Graham—Mr B. Rathbun); “Coaches” (Warren Bullock —Mr W. Hcskins); “Parents and Supporters” (Mr N. Messenger—Messrs E. Harris, W. Messenger, P. Maughan and F. Brennan); “The Ladies” (Mr C. Morel —Mr E. Kerridge).
